Thin Blue Line Flag
29" x 13"
Torched and colored with a strip of blue to honor our police enforcement topped with glossy automotive clear coat for stability indoors or outdoors. Handcrafted in Topeka, Kansas from steel.
The torn and tattered flag is a symbol of perseverance and tenacity during times of otherwise insurmountable adversity. From the original weathered stitches of William Driver’s Old Glory in 1824 to the iconic images taken from a battered Pearl Harbor flagpole in early December 1941, to modern applications of PTSD awareness, we hope that this flag emboldens and inspires feelings of patriotism and unity for all who see it.
